Background technology
In roadbed dirt work progress, the detection to compactness is the most important thing of quality control, if compactness detected value It is unqualified, then the overall construction quality in road surface will be largely influenceed, and in a short time road surface will be tied Structure destroys, and the diseases such as chicken-wire cracking and pit occurs in road table.
In roadbed dirt work progress at this stage, the detection to compactness generally all uses《Highway subgrade road surface shows Field test procedure》(JTGE60-2008) sand replacement method provided in carries out Field Compactness detection.So-called sand replacement method detection compacting Degree, i.e., the soil sample after the completion of compacting is replaced by the normal sand of known apparent density in equal volume, so as to which dirt be calculated The actual dry density in scene, and compared with the standard maximum dry density that laboratory test obtains, obtain actual compactness.
In actual mechanical process, because weighing device is separately provided, when weighing every time, it is required for a filling sand cylinder to move title to Refitting is put, using trouble, and labor strength is big.
Utility model content
The purpose of this utility model is:A kind of sand replacement method detection backfill soil compaction device for fast detecting is aimed to provide, is used To solve the problem of inconvenient for use caused by existing structure of the detecting device defect, labor strength is big.
To realize above-mentioned technical purpose, the technical solution adopted in the utility model is as follows:
A kind of sand replacement method detection backfill soil compaction device for fast detecting, including substrate, substrate upper surface center position First through hole is installed, the substrate upper surface is provided with first annular boss in first through hole edge, and the surface is provided with Hole pressing device, the hole pressing device are the barrel-like structure that upper surface is provided with bottom plate, and the diameter dimension of the hole pressing device is slightly less than first and led to The diameter dimension in hole, the surface, which is additionally provided with, fills sand cylinder, and sandpipe is provided with out in the filling sand cylinder, it is described go out sandpipe be provided with and open Close, the filling sand cylinder lower surface is provided with the second annular boss, and the second annular boss lower surface is provided with pressure sensor, described Fill sand cylinder front end face and be provided with display screen, the display screen electrically connects with pressure sensor, and the filling sand cylinder upper surface is provided with the 3rd Annular boss, the internal diameter size of the 3rd annular boss are more than the outside dimension of hole pressing device.
Using the utility model of above-mentioned technical proposal, in use, first that land clearing is clean, substrate, which is placed on, to be needed to examine The position of survey, then hole pressing device is placed in the first through hole of substrate, firmly hole pressing device is pushed, or use hammer etc Thing beats hole pressing device, ground a circle is occurred, removes hole pressing device, filling sand cylinder is placed on first annular boss upper surface, Now, pressure sensor stress, measure and now fill sand cylinder and fill the weight m1 of the normal sand in sand cylinder, and show on a display screen Show to come, then open switch, make the standard hourglass in filling sand cylinder in first through hole, leak, close until normal sand is no longer lower Switch, the now weight registration m2 on display screen is recorded, then substrate and filling sand cylinder are taken away, the standard that recovery previous step is spilt Sand, and then the circle extruded along hole pressing device is inverted hole pressing device in ground punching, the soil that punching is made is put into hole pressing device, After punching terminates, substrate is placed on the ground, and ground is alignd by punched hole with first through hole, then filling sand cylinder is placed On first annular boss, and weight registration m3 now is recorded, open and fill sand cylinder switch, enter the normal sand in filling sand cylinder In the hole on ground, leaked until normal sand is no longer lower, closing switch records display screen registration m4 now, finally hole pressing device is put Put and filling above sand cylinder, be set in the 3rd annular boss, and record display screen registration m5 now, finally in hole pressing device Soil is outwelled, and hole pressing device is placed on again and filled above sand cylinder, display screen registration m6 now is recorded, by formula m3-m4- (m1- M2 the quality of hole internal standard sand) is calculated, m6-m5 calculates the native quality made in hole.Such structure design, weighing device Pressure sensor is replaced with, and installed in sand cylinder bottom is filled, avoids each weigh and is required for a filling sand cylinder to lift to weighing device The problem of upper, workflow was simplified, and reduced the working strength of worker.
Further limit, described hole pressing device or so end face is respectively provided with a first in command.Such structure design, convenient pair The operation of hole pressing device, practicality are stronger.
Further limit, multiple reinforcing plates are longitudinally uniformly provided with the hole pressing device.Such structure design, it can strengthen pressing The structural strength of hole device, prevents hole pressing device from deforming.
Further limit, described filling sand cylinder or so end face is respectively provided with a second in command.Such structure design, convenient pair The operation of sand cylinder is filled, practicality is stronger.
Further limit, the display screen is detachably connected by bolt with filling sand cylinder.Such structure design, it can simplify Structure, it is cost-effective.
